Unusual Two-Gallon Stoneware Jug with Cobalt Bird Decoration, Stamped "O.L. & A.K. BALLARD. / BURLINGTON, VT", circa 1860, cylindrical jug with pronounced spout, decorated with a folky slip-trailed design of a bird with long tail and well-detailed body, perched on a stylized branch. Light cobalt highlights to maker's mark. The bird decoration includes purplish flecks throughout and may have a small concentration of manganese mixed into the cobalt slip. A 2" U-shaped crack at base. A small chip on exterior of spout adjacent to a 1 1/4" crack on top of spout. A small chip on interior of spout.
